If you made it to rank 2, you have plenty of skill. But it does take lots of patience, and some luck.
I made it to legend the last 3 seasons. The grind from 5-Legend is awful. Even really good players who stream will struggle at times. And some of them player 6-8 hours per day(!) and get to legend within a week or so.
Do you have time for that? Do you really care that much?
When I pulled it off last month I did by about the middle of the month and I had lots of time to play. This month, I don't know if I can do it. And I'm not losing any sleep over it.
